I recently bought a physical copy of the Quran for my personal study, and it was easier than I expected. Local Islamic bookstores often carry various editions, from pocket-sized to large, beautifully bound versions. I found mine at a nearby store that specializes in religious texts. They had multiple translations and commentaries, which was helpful. If you don't have a local store, online retailers like Amazon or specialized Islamic shops like Islamic Bookstore.com offer a wide range. I recommend checking reviews to find a reputable translation, like 'The Noble Quran' or 'Sahih International,' as clarity matters. Some mosques also distribute or sell copies, so it’s worth asking around.

Purchasing a physical copy of the Quran can be a meaningful experience, especially if you’re particular about the edition. I spent time comparing translations and formats before settling on one. For beginners, 'The Clear Quran' by Dr. Mustafa Khattab is highly recommended for its modern English. If you prefer a bilingual edition with Arabic and English, websites like Kitaabun.com or Dar-us-Salam have great options.

For those who appreciate craftsmanship, luxury editions with gold-edged pages and leather bindings are available from publishers like Osoul Center or Al-Furqan Foundation. I ordered mine from Dar Al-Ma'arifa, and the quality was exceptional. Local Islamic centers often have free or low-cost copies for new Muslims or students. If you’re unsure, visiting a mosque can provide guidance on where to buy or even borrow a copy temporarily.

Online marketplaces like eBay or Etsy sometimes carry vintage or rare editions, but verify the seller’s credibility. I’ve seen beautiful Ottoman-style Qurans there, though they tend to be pricey. Don’t overlook digital options first if you want to preview translations before committing to a physical book.

I love collecting religious texts, and the Quran was a recent addition to my shelf. I discovered that many mainstream bookstores, like Barnes & Noble, stock popular translations such as 'The Quran' by M.A.S. Abdel Haleem. It’s surprisingly accessible. For a more curated experience, I visited a specialty Islamic shop where the staff helped me choose between interpretations like 'The Meaning of the Holy Quran' by Abdullah Yusuf Ali and others.

If you’re budget-conscious, thrift stores or secondhand bookshops occasionally have copies, though condition varies. I once found a well-preserved 1980s edition at a library sale. For online shoppers, platforms like Book Depository offer free shipping worldwide, which is handy if you’re outside major cities. Some publishers even include study guides or tafsir (commentary) bundled with the Quran, which I found useful for deeper understanding.

A friend recommended checking university libraries for sales—they sometimes discard duplicates. Whether you want a travel-sized Quran or a family heirloom, there’s an option for every need.

Does quran the book have an official publisher?

3 Answers2025-08-17 13:27:50
I've always been curious about the origins of religious texts, and the Quran is no exception. From what I understand, the Quran itself doesn't have a single 'official publisher' in the way modern books do, since it's considered by Muslims to be the literal word of God as revealed to the Prophet Muhammad. However, there are many respected publishing houses that produce printed versions of the Quran, often with translations and commentary. These publishers are usually based in Muslim-majority countries and are recognized for their accuracy and adherence to traditional Islamic scholarship. The King Fahd Complex for the Printing of the Holy Quran in Saudi Arabia is one of the most well-known, distributing millions of copies worldwide. It's fascinating how the Quran's dissemination has evolved from oral tradition to mass printing while maintaining its sacred status.

Who is the publisher of the quran english book version?

3 Answers2025-08-03 08:25:57
when it comes to English translations of the Quran, there are several reputable publishers. One of the most widely recognized is Penguin Classics, which publishes a translation by N.J. Dawood. Another notable publisher is Oxford University Press, known for their scholarly approach with translations like those by M.A.S. Abdel Haleem. I also appreciate the work of Saheeh International, a group that produces clear and accessible translations. Each publisher brings a unique perspective, whether it's the literary flair of Penguin or the academic rigor of Oxford. It's fascinating how different translations can highlight various aspects of the text.

Which publishers offer the best print version to read Quran book?

3 Answers2025-07-15 12:55:06
I’ve always been particular about the quality of printed books, especially when it comes to sacred texts like the Quran. After comparing several editions, I found that Dar Al-Ma'arifa produces one of the most elegant and durable print versions. Their paper quality is thick and crisp, preventing ink bleed-through, and the binding is sturdy enough to withstand frequent use. The font size is generous, making it easy to read without straining the eyes. They also include helpful features like color-coded tajweed rules, which are a blessing for beginners. The attention to detail in their layout—such as clear verse numbering and spacious margins—sets it apart from others. It’s a no-frills, respectful presentation that prioritizes readability and longevity. Another publisher worth mentioning is Noorart, which offers a sleek, travel-friendly edition with a synthetic leather cover. It’s lightweight yet resilient, perfect for daily carry. Their use of high-contrast ink ensures clarity, and the compact size doesn’t compromise font legibility. For those who appreciate aesthetics, their minimalist design feels modern without sacrificing tradition.
